Timing Your Move

Timing your move can significantly impact the overall cost of long-distance moving in Quail Country Place, Phoenix. Rates for moving services tend to fluctuate based on the season. Planning your move during the off-peak months, typically in the winter, can yield more affordable options. Additionally, weekdays often present better rates than weekends, as fewer people choose to relocate during these times.

Booking your moving service well in advance can lead to substantial savings. Many companies offer discounts for early reservations. Taking into account holidays, especially those associated with long weekends, is crucial, as these periods often see a spike in demand and consequently, higher prices. By strategically selecting your moving date, you can take advantage of lower rates and avoid unnecessary stress during your relocation.

Finding Affordable Packing Supplies

When planning for a move, sourcing affordable packing supplies can significantly cut costs. Many people overlook places like local grocery stores and liquor stores, which often have sturdy boxes available for free. Be proactive and ask for any spare packing materials they may have on hand. You can also check community groups on social media platforms where people frequently offer leftover supplies from their own moves. These methods can provide you with quality materials without the added expense.

Another creative option is to utilize household items as packing materials. Towels, blankets, and linens can double as cushioning for fragile items, which saves on the need for bubble wrap. Additionally, using suitcases and bags you already own can minimize the need for extra boxes. Downsizing Before the Move

Downsizing before a move can significantly reduce the costs associated with long-distance relocation. Start by evaluating each item in your home and asking whether it is essential or brings you joy. This process helps in determining what to keep, sell, or donate. The fewer items you own, the less you will need to pack and transport, making your long-distance moving in Quail Country Place, Phoenix, much more manageable.

Getting creative with how you downsize can also lead to extra savings. Consider hosting a garage sale to sell items you no longer need. Many communities have buy-nothing groups on social media where you can give away items that others might find useful. By reducing your belongings through these methods, you can declutter your space and ease the burden of your upcoming move.
